#include <print.h> |
#include <test.h> |
#include <mm/page.h> |
#include <mm/frame.h> |
#include <arch/mm/page.h> |
#include <arch/types.h> |
#include <debug.h> |
|
#define PAGE0 0x10000000 |
#define PAGE1 (PAGE0+PAGE_SIZE) |
|
#define VALUE0 0x01234567 |
#define VALUE1 0x89abcdef |
|
void test(void) |
{ |
__address frame0, frame1; |
__u32 v0, v1; |
|
printf("Memory management test mapping #1\n"); |
|
frame0 = frame_alloc(FRAME_KA); |
frame1 = frame_alloc(FRAME_KA); |
|
*((__u32 *) frame0) = VALUE0; |
*((__u32 *) frame1) = VALUE1; |
|
printf("Mapping %X to %X.\n", PAGE0, KA2PA(frame0)); |
map_page_to_frame(PAGE0, KA2PA(frame0), PAGE_PRESENT, 0); |
printf("Mapping %X to %X.\n", PAGE1, KA2PA(frame1)); |
map_page_to_frame(PAGE1, KA2PA(frame1), PAGE_PRESENT, 0); |
|
printf("Value at %X is %X.\n", PAGE0, v0 = *((__u32 *) PAGE0)); |
printf("Value at %X is %X.\n", PAGE1, v1 = *((__u32 *) PAGE1)); |
|
ASSERT(v0 == VALUE0); |
ASSERT(v1 == VALUE1); |
|
printf("Writing 0 to %X.\n", PAGE0); |
*((__u32 *) PAGE0) = 0; |
printf("Writing 0 to %X.\n", PAGE1); |
*((__u32 *) PAGE1) = 0; |
|
printf("Value at %X is %X.\n", PAGE0, v0 = *((__u32 *) PAGE0)); |
printf("Value at %X is %X.\n", PAGE1, v1 = *((__u32 *) PAGE1)); |
|
ASSERT(v0 == 0); |
ASSERT(v1 == 0); |
|
printf("Test passed.\n"); |
|
} |
